If you decide to clean it yourself, here are some steps to follow:

1. Safety Gear: Wear protective clothing such as gloves, goggles, and a mask to prevent inhaling spores.
2. Ventilation: Open windows or use fans to improve air circulation. Ensure the area is well-ventilated during cleaning.
3. Cleaning Agents: Use a solution of water and detergent or a mixture of vinegar and water for light mold growth. For more stubborn cases, a commercial mold cleaner might be necessary.
4. Scrubbing: Gently scrub the affected area with a brush or sponge to remove as much mold as possible.
5. Drying: Once cleaned, ensure the area is thoroughly dried to prevent recurrence.

However, if the mold covers more than 10 square feet or is on porous materials like drywall, carpets, or ceiling tiles, it’s best to hire professionals. They have the proper equipment and techniques to handle these cases safely.

In Dubai, expect costs for professional mold remediation to vary based on the extent of the problem and type of service required. A basic inspection might cost around AED 500-1000, while a full remediation project could range from AED 2000-8000 depending on the scale.
